«optimization» 태그된 질문

이 태그는 (제약되거나 제한되지 않은) 기능의 최소화 또는 최대화 방법에 대한 질문을위한 것입니다.

17
파이썬을위한 고품질 비선형 프로그래밍 솔버가 있습니까?
볼록하지 않은 전역 최적화 문제를 해결해야 할 몇 가지 문제가 있습니다. 현재 MATLAB의 Optimization Toolbox (특히 fmincon()algorithm = 사용 'sqp')를 사용하고 있습니다. 그러나 내 코드의 대부분은 Python이며 Python에서도 최적화를하고 싶습니다. 파이썬 바인딩과 경쟁 할 수있는 NLP 솔버가 fmincon()있습니까? 반드시 비선형 평등과 불평등 제약을 다룰 수있다 사용자가 Jacobian을 제공하도록 요구하지 않습니다. …

3
BFGS 대 결합 그라디언트 방법
최적화를 위해 BFGS와 켤레 기울기 중에서 선택할 때 고려해야 할 사항은 무엇입니까? 이 변수에 맞추려고하는 함수는 지수 함수입니다. 그러나 실제 객관적인 기능은 무엇보다도 통합과 관련이 있으며, 그것이 도움이된다면 비용이 많이 듭니다.

8
제한된 최적화를위한 소프트웨어 패키지?
일부 변수 (특히 상자 제약 조건)의 경계를 알고있는 제한된 최적화 문제를 해결하려고합니다. argminuf(u,x)arg⁡minuf(u,x) \arg \min_u f(u,x) 에 따라 c(u,x)=0c(u,x)=0 c(u,x) = 0 a≤d(u,x)≤ba≤d(u,x)≤b a \le d(u,x) \le b 여기서 uuu 는 설계 변수의 벡터이고, xxx 는 상태 변수의 벡터이며, c(u,x)c(u,x)c(u,x) 는 등식 제약 조건 (일반적으로 PDE)입니다. 하한 및 상한 제약 …

3
비 볼록성이 최적화에서 왜 문제가됩니까?
볼록하지 않은 최적화에 대한 일반적인 내용을 읽었을 때 매우 놀랐고 다음과 같은 진술을 보았습니다. 중요한 많은 실질적인 문제는 볼록하지 않으며, 볼록하지 않은 대부분의 문제는 합리적인 시간에 정확하게 해결하기가 어렵습니다 (불가능하지는 않지만). ( 소스 ) 또는 일반적으로 로컬 최소값을 찾는 것은 NP-hard이며 많은 알고리즘이 새들 포인트에 멈출 수 있습니다. ( 소스 …

3
일부 최적화 문제는 시간 단계와 동일하다는 것이 잘 알려져 있습니까?
원하는 상태 와이0와이0y_0 과 정규화 매개 변수 β∈ Rβ∈아르 자형\beta \in \mathbb R 을 고려하여 , 기능 을 최소화하기 위해 상태 와이와이y 와 제어 유유u 를 찾는 문제를 고려하십시오.Ay=u입니다. y,y0,u∈RnA∈Rn×n12∥ y− y0∥2+ β2∥ u ∥212”와이−와이0”2+β2”유”2\begin{equation} \frac{1}{2} \| y - y_0 \|^2 + \frac{\beta}{2} \| u \|^2 \end{equation}Y= u .ㅏ와이=유.\begin{equation} Ay …

3
GPU에서 제한되지 않은 비선형 최적화 문제 해결
GPU (CUDA)에서 제한되지 않은 비선형 최적화 문제를 해결하려고합니다. 목적 함수는 부드러운 비선형 함수이며 기울기는 분석적으로 계산하기에 상대적으로 저렴하므로 수치 근사로 신경 쓸 필요가 없습니다. 대부분의 fp32 수학 연산 으로이 문제를 해결하고 싶습니다 (다양한 이유로). 비선형 최적화 방법은 반올림 오류에 대해 더 강력하지만 성능이 우수합니까? (예를 들어 켤레 그라디언트 / 쿼시 …

5
평가 비용이 많이 드는 매끄럽고 경계가있는 볼록하지 않은 2D 함수의 전역 최소값 찾기
최소의 범위를 찾고자하는 비 볼록 2D 기능이 있습니다. 이 기능은 매우 부드럽습니다. 그것을 평가하는 것은 비용이 많이 든다. 허용 가능한 오류는 각 축에서 함수 도메인의 약 3 %입니다. NLOPT 라이브러리에서 DIRECT 알고리즘의 구현을 시도했지만 필요한 정확도에 필요한 함수 평가량 측면에서 무차별 강제 검색보다 크게 개선되지 않았으며 일부 이상 치가있었습니다. 다른 …

3

6
선형 프로그램에서
가정 minAvec(U)subject to Ui,j≤max{Ui,k,Uk,j},i,j,k=1,…,nminAvec(U)subject to Ui,j≤max{Ui,k,Uk,j},i,j,k=1,…,n\begin{align*} \min A &\mathrm{vec}(U) \\ &\text{subject to } U_{i,j} \leq \max\{U_{i,k}, U_{k,j}\}, \quad i,j,k = 1, \ldots, n \end{align*} 여기서 UUU 는 대칭 n×nn×nn\times n 행렬이고 U 2 를 n 2 항목 으로 1 차원 벡터로 vec(U)vec(U)\mathrm{vec}(U)재구성 합니다.UUUn2n2n^2 위의 프로그램에서 문제를 일으키는 부분은 max{⋅,⋅}max{⋅,⋅}\max\{⋅,⋅\} 입니다. …

3
과학 프로그래밍 콘테스트
저는 정기적으로 소위 "프로그래밍 콘테스트 (Programming Contests)"에서 경쟁합니다. 여기서 제한된 시간 동안 자신의 코드로 문제를 해결하고 문제 해결 기술을 사용하여 어려운 알고리즘 문제를 해결할 수 있습니다. 이러한 모양에 대한 참조 예를 보려면 Google Code Jam 또는 ACM-ICPC와 같은 경쟁을 검색하십시오. (프로그래밍 콘테스트가 무엇인지 아는 경우 다음 단락을 건너 뛸 수 …

4
일련의 점에서 가장 흩어진 점 선택
부분 집합을 선택하는 (효율적인) 알고리즘이 있습니까?MMM 세트로부터 포인트 점 ( M &lt; N (크기의 모든 가능한 부분 집합을 통해) 예들은 "표지"대부분의 영역 M은 )?NNNM&lt;NM&lt;NM < NMMM 점이 2D 평면에 있다고 가정합니다. 순진한 알고리즘은 단순하지만 시간 복잡성 측면에서 금지 적입니다. for each subset of N points sum distance between each pair …

5
매우 고가의 목적 함수 문제에 대한 병렬 최적화 알고리즘
10-20 변수의 함수를 최적화하고 있습니다. 나쁜 소식은 각 함수 평가가 약 30 분의 직렬 계산으로 비싸다는 것입니다. 좋은 소식은 내가 수십 개의 계산 노드를 가진 클러스터를 가지고 있다는 것입니다. 따라서 모든 계산 능력을 효율적으로 사용할 수있는 최적화 알고리즘이 있습니까? 스펙트럼의 한쪽에는 철저한 검색이 있습니다. 전체 검색 공간을 미세 그리드로 세분화하고 …

1
BFGS 업데이트에 대한 직관적 동기
나는 수치 분석 설문 수업을 가르치고 있으며 최적화에 대한 배경 / 직관이 제한된 학생들을 위해 BFGS 방법에 대한 동기를 찾고 있습니다! 모든 것이 수렴한다는 것을 증명할 시간은 없지만 BFGS Hessian 업데이트가 나타나는 이유에 대해 합리적인 동기를 부여하려고합니다. 유사하게, Broyden의 근본 찾기 방법 (내 글은 여기에 있습니다 )은 야곱 인의 현재 …

4
수치 최적화 방법 테스트 : Rosenbrock 및 실제 테스트 기능
비 파생 최적화 프로그램에는 두 가지 주요 테스트 기능이있는 것 같습니다. Rosenbrock 기능 과 같은 1 개의 라이너 , 시작 지점 보간 기와 함께 실제 데이터 포인트 세트 10d Rosenbrock을 실제 10d 문제와 비교할 수 있습니까? 다양한 방법으로 비교할 수 있습니다. 로컬 최소의 구조를 설명 하거나 Rosenbrock 및 일부 실제 …

4
엄격한 양성 구속 조건을 가진 선형 프로그래밍 타당성 문제
선형 제약 시스템 있습니다. 이러한 제약 조건을 만족 하는 엄격하게 양의 벡터 을 찾고 싶습니다 . 즉, 의 모든 구성 요소 에 이 필요합니다 . LP 솔버를 사용하여 엄격하게 양의 벡터 찾거나 가 없는지 확인하려면 어떻게해야합니까? LP에서 동등성을 항상 허용해야하기 때문에 다른 제약 조건 간단히 도입 할 수는 없지만 , …

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.